    When RT says “its too difficult” to upload to YouTube, I don’t think they mean that they don’t have anyone in their studio that now has dozens of employees that can figure out how to upload a video anymore.

    If the algorithm wasn’t complex, someone would have reversed engineered it. For example, “x” number of profanities and you are demonized. Instead, its something like a 7 factor test that includes things like the strength of the profanity, where in the video it is placed (explicitly, profanity right in the beginning or in the title will get a ban), and maybe affected by things like what sort of content the video has otherwise, the popularity of the video and the author, and what goes on in the comments.

    That’s just profanity. Then there’s the question of whether you violated copyright which probably has many of the same or similar tests, but also some different ones (perhaps, for example, uploading enough high quality animation is enough to get flagged for copyright).

    I think they absolutely throw heightened scrutiny against smaller authors and less popular channels and videos. Also, there may be a buildup effect, if they demonitized you before they may be more likely to do so again.

    You can find people talking about the various factors, but how YouTube reduces that into a formula that gets implemented through their bots (supplemented with actual humans) isn’t something you will be able to express in an algorithm.
